About the role


Office:
Richmond Hill, ON

To provide operational and administrative support and quality standards to the Personal Financial Services business. Overall nature of work is of low to moderate complexity.

Training:
Conducted in-office and at the conclusion of training the role offers Hybrid work model (2-3 days in office).


Responsibilities:


  • Identify and understand basic customer needs in order to complete transactions and resolve issues quickly and efficiently.
  • Maintain superior and courteous service to internal and external contacts.
  • Ensure work area is maintained in accordance with HSBC standards.
  • Deliver fair outcomes for our customers and ensure own conduct maintains the orderly and transparent operation of financial markets.
  • Promotes and contributes to teambased approach in completing tasks and meeting internal and external customer needs.
  • Provide guidance to Operations Risk and Administration Associates, Personal Bankers and Premium Bankers.
  • Participates in quality, regulatory and compliance training in order to meet performance targets.
  • Promotes an environment that supports diversity.
  • Demonstrates Group capabilities.
  • Promote an environment that supports diversity and reflects the HSBC brand.
  • Ensure that all employees are aware of and effectively identify and manage applicable money laundering (ML), terrorist financing (TF), sanctions and reputational risks.
  • Complete other responsibilities, as assigned.
Requirements

  • Must have at least 1 year in customer service and contact center experience.
  • Must be fluent in English and Mandarin or Cantonese.
  • Must have completed or be able to pass the CSC (Canadian Securities Course) and the CPH (Conduct and Practices Handbook Course) within following 3 months of hire.
  • Availability to be scheduled between Monday Friday 8am to 8pm.
  • Team player, strong communication, customer service and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to learn and operate new software and technology.
  • Detailed orientated with good time management and organizational skills.
  • Ability to multitask, handle large volumes, tight turnarounds, multiple deadlines and to work independently.
  • Some experience with conflict resolution required.
